    You gotta remember, there was just ANH (which wasn't even called that) and then you found the comic and was like, well, here's more Star Wars, and this rabbit guy is the kind of thing that's in Star Wars. Did we (kids at the time) "love" him? I dunno, he was just part of Star Wars, before almost everything else we know as Star Wars existed. And the piece is right, those stories get the SW vibe surprisingly right. It coulda been Trek-ish, it coulda been even more Flash Gordon-y, the tone could have been anything, but they went for western/samurai.
